Summer Series: Area Athletes Update

1) After two years in retirement, tennis star Kim Clijsters made a successful return, upsetting third-seeded Venus Williams in three sets to become the first female wild-card entry to reach the U.S. Open quarterfinals. 2) Local racer Kasey Kahne won the NASCAR Sprint Cup race in Atlanta, his second win of the year, positioning him well for the Chase for the Championship playoffs. 3) Thirty-two years ago, Yelm High School's Patsy Walker won the 1A state track and field championship entirely by herself, an unprecedented feat that is still difficult to believe given the era and lack of opportunities for female athletes at the time.
